I worked at a pizza place and the way we did it there stuck with me:
Push in on the stem while it’s whole, it’ll fall in with the core, then split it in half with your hands (you have thumbs on the inside so it’s easy), dump out the innards, then pat the skins to get all the seeds out of the inside. Lay the skins flat (they’ll break a bit to go flat) and then you can slice n dice however you like
